The final viewership numbers for this past Friday’s June 5 episode of WWE Friday Night SmackDown on FOX has been revealed.
As per ShowBuzzDaily, the show drew an average of 1.984 million viewers, which is an increase from the overnight figure of 1.935 million that came out on Saturday.
It is, however, still the second lowest figure that the blue brand has achieved on FOX since it moved to the network last October. The lowest was the 1.885 million average on May 1.
It’s down from the previous week’s average of 2.17 million, and placed #9 for the night on Network TV for the second week in a row.
Advertised prior to the show were three non-wrestling segments and a Women’s Tag Team Championship match.
